Markets Surge in Q3 2025 as Small Caps and Global Equities Regain Momentum
In Q3 2025, markets climbed across the board, fueled by strong corporate earnings, falling interest rates, and renewed global trade clarity. U.S. small caps hit record highs, China rebounded sharply, and gold extended a stellar run. With the Fed easing policy and inflation cooling below 3%, investors enter Q4 on a cautiously optimistic note—buoyed by resilient earnings, robust liquidity, and the potential for continued gains in both stocks and bonds.
